Fully renovated character home | 546mΒ² secure allotment | Prime Newtown location | Walking distance to elite schools
This property presents a competitively strong offering within the Newtown market, merging a fully renovated, move-in-ready character home with a low-maintenance, secure allotment in a premier location. The extensive, high-quality renovations executed within the past six months-including new flooring, cabinetry, driveway, and multiple air conditioning units-eliminate immediate capital expenditure for a buyer and position the house above typical period stock requiring updates. Its configuration of four bedrooms on a single level, combined with walking proximity to sought-after schools like The Glennie School and Laurel Bank Park, squarely targets owner-occupier families seeking established charm without the renovation burden. The propertyΒs prime positioning capitalizes on the suburb’s demonstrated growth, serving a buyer who values both timeless aesthetic appeal and modern functionality.
Proceed with the clear risk that the price per square metre significantly exceeds typical suburban benchmarks, reflecting a premium for the recent renovations and location. This premium demands validation through a precise comparative sales analysis, focusing on recently renovated four-bedroom character homes on similar allotments in Newtown, as historical data suggests a possible discrepancy in bedroom count that must be clarified. The opportunity lies in acquiring a turnkey property in a high-demand enclave, where the rental yield aligns with suburb averages, providing a solid foundation for either long-term holding or immediate occupancy. Given the complete renovation and strong locational fundamentals, this property is best acquired as a permanent residence or a long-term hold, with its value sustained by the scarcity of updated character homes in prime school catchments.
Recent comparable sales context is critical. The property last sold for $641,000 two years ago; the current asking price implies a substantial increase that must be justified by the comprehensive renovation and market movement. While specific nearby sales are not detailed in the provided data, this gap necessitates immediate investigation. A buyer must commission a formal valuation to test the $899,000+ asking price against post-renovation sales of comparable homes, as the suburb’s 21% growth figure alone does not validate this specific premium.

Market Insight:
Newtown is a sought-after inner-city suburb offering walkable access to Toowoomba’s CBD, characterised by its leafy streetscapes and historic charm. Demand is driven by a mix of young professionals, singles, and families seeking entry-level opportunities and a vibrant, convenient lifestyle. The market exhibits strong recent price growth across both houses and units, with conditions remaining tight due to low supply and a competitive rental market. Future growth is anchored in its enduring appeal and proximity to amenities, though continued price pressures and limited listings present key constraints for buyers and investors.
